苹果app开发成本是否比安卓高?
苹果app开发成本不一定比安卓高。这个问题涉及多个方面,包括开发工具、语言、设备碎片化、设计需求、测试和适配等,以下是对这些方面的详细分析:开发工具和语言:iOS开发:使用Xcode作为主要的集成开发环境(IDE),支持Objective-C和Swift两种编程语言。

从硬件成本来看:安卓app开发可能更贵。在app测试阶段,特别是针对不同手机型号的测试,安卓app需要覆盖更多机型,因为Android市场上的手机型号五花八门。而开发苹果app则只需测试苹果手机一种机型。因此,从这一角度看,安卓app开发的硬件成本(如购买不同型号手机进行测试)可能更高。
Android平台开发中是使用Java,ios平台则是使用的Objective-C和Swift。需要注意的是,如果你是要用ios进行开发,就必须具备一个Apple设备,所以成本可能会比安卓的成本高些。
平台差异:苹果系统(iOS)开发成本通常高于安卓系统。原因包括苹果平台的封闭性、Objective-C开发语言的难度,以及苹果对App审核的严格标准。人力成本:基础团队配置包括产品经理、客户端工程师、后端工程师和UI设计师各一名,月薪总和可能超过4~5万元。项目周期越长,人力成本越高。
苹果应用商店对开发者收取3%的额外费用,这导致苹果应用的价格普遍高于安卓应用。这些费用由最终用户承担,因为他们购买应用或进行消费时,需要支付较高的价格。无论是美团、滴滴打车还是充值服务,只要涉及消费,苹果应用的价格就会比安卓应用高出不少。苹果应用商店的商业模式决定了应用价格的差异。
一般来说,制作苹果系统的手机APP软件费用要比安卓平台的贵一些,因为苹果公司对苹果平台的封闭性和手机APP开发语言Objective-C的难度,都让APP开发者加大了苹果系统手机APP开发的难度。
为什么app开发创业者青睐ios平台
创业公司首选开发 iOS APP不仅仅是为了便宜省事,还因为 iOS 用户对于应用内购买消费能力更强,广告商也更愿意投放 iOS 内置广告。根据 Facebook 此前针对在线广告的研究,在 iOS 平台投放广告相比 Android 平台要有利可图的多。创业公司花在 Android 产品开发上面的钱与时间可没那么容易收回来。
大部分APP开发公司都认为,ios下软件与硬件的匹配更完美,拿分辨率来说,安卓机器的分辨率很多个,开发者只能按照主流通用的分辨率开发app。而ios机器目前也只要2,3个分辨率,基本可以通用。安卓APP的电影,电子书随便放哪儿,随便用哪个软件,打开就看。ios只能放指定app下。
”TechCrunch编辑Greg Kumparak也提到,在Yahoo的气象App里,有些东西是Android上面从未见过的。规格统一,较能预估产品呈现状态Flipboard共同创办人Evan Doll:“iOS 和 Android平台有着不同的优点,让他们的产品最后变得截然不同。
如果你是一个个人软件开发者, iOS适合你, 市场规范, 做应用省心。如果你是一个软件和服务的创业公司, iOS也是适合你做demo的和第一个产品的, 产品靠谱了,用户在用了,有人给钱了,再往Android走也是可行的。
开发App之前要先想好商业模式 很多创业者在有了一个创意想法之后,便会立即着手开发App应用,但是笔者要提醒的是,你最好对自己的App的商业模式要有一个清晰的理解。通常来说,将App作为一种平台,帮助两个相互依存的群体进行交流是一种不错的商业模式。
适用于iOS平台开发新手和想要增强创意的开发人员。 应用公园 简介:应用公园是国内最早、功能最全、使用人数最多的App在线制作平台之一。它提供了丰富的功能模块和模板,允许用户通过积木式搭建来创建手机APP。这款工具非常适合那些想要快速开发并上线APP的创业者。特点:积木式搭建,无需编程。
苹果App开发有什么优势
虽然苹果平台在某些方面(如设备和碎片化、设计和用户体验)具有优势,能够降低一些开发和测试成本,但在其他方面(如发布和审核)可能增加一些成本。因此,无法一概而论地说苹果app开发成本一定比安卓高。最终的开发成本取决于具体的项目需求、开发人员的经验以及市场定位等多个因素。在选择开发平台时,应综合考虑项目目标、受众需求和预算等因素。
开放性:从开放性上来说,安卓APP开发具有更大的灵活性。安卓系统开放了更多的应用接口(API),使得开发者能够更自由地实现各种功能。这也使得安卓APP的功能可能要比iOS APP的功能更加强大。然而,相对应的是iOS APP开发的安全性更高。
优势一:IOS APP营收更容易 相同的一个应用,同时在安卓与苹果平台上发布运营,用户更加愿意在其消费。
APP的性能 IOS:由于其拥有一套独立的操作系统和开发环境,IOS应用在性能上通常会比安卓应用更好。IOS系统对硬件资源的优化更加出色,且对应用的审核和管理更加严格,这有助于确保应用的稳定性和安全性。
主要推荐语言:Swift是苹果公司强烈推荐的主要编程语言,专门用于开发iOS、iPadOS、watchOS和macOS应用。现代、安全、高效:Swift语言自2014年推出以来,凭借其现代性、安全性和高效性,迅速成为了iOS应用开发的主流语言。
Swift采用了安全的编程模式,并添加了许多现代功能,如类型推断、闭包、泛型等,极大地提高了开发效率和代码的安全性。同时,Swift与Objective-C具有很好的互操作性,开发者可以在同一个项目中混合使用这两种语言。综上所述,苹果APP主要使用Objective-C和Swift这两种编程语言进行开发。
为什么开发苹果app只能用苹果系统
开发系统:MACOS,也就是说只能在装有苹果系统的电脑上开发APP,意味着要么你需要买一天苹果电脑,要么你需要利用虚拟软件比如vmware在你装有windows或者其他系统的电脑上装上苹果系统才行。开发环境:cocoa,cocoa是苹果建立的开发环境,基本上所有你需要的东西都要借助于cocoa。开发工具XCODE,这点无需多述。开发语言objectivec。
苹果手机的系统是封闭的,这意味着用户只能下载并安装iOS系统的软件。苹果对应用商店App Store有着严格的控制,确保所有软件都符合其安全和质量标准。因此,任何非iOS应用都无法在iOS设备上运行。
第一,苹果的审核制度非常严格。因为使用苹果手机的用户粘性非常高,所以开发者优先更新IOS版。如果在苹果商店销售的话,设计规范要求非常严格,而审核也卡得非常紧,安卓就相对松一点,所以很多的开发者把IOS当成了一块试金石,你若是在IOS上审核不出问题,那在安卓上面往往很轻松的通过。
苹果app为什么要收费
在之前,我使用的苹果6手机上,下载的APP中的免费软件都是不收费的。但现在,我发现很多原本免费的软件都开始收费了。这可能是因为随着越来越多的人下载和使用这些软件,开发者为了盈利开始实施收费策略。
这种变化背后的原因主要是开发者为了提高收入,而苹果公司也在调整其应用商店的政策。随着应用商店的用户数量不断增加,开发者获取的广告收入和其他盈利模式变得有限。为了更好地支持自己的应用开发工作,他们选择通过应用内购买或直接收费的方式来获得收入。
iPhone5上苹果app显示免费却要求付费的情况可能是由两种原因导致的:内购付费或账户设置问题。内购付费 有些应用程序本身是免费的,但它们内部可能包含一些需要额外付费的功能或道具,这种付费方式被称为“内购”。因此,即使应用程序显示为免费下载,但在使用过程中可能会遇到需要付费的情况。
iPad上的App在下载时显示App购买,意思是应用程序打开后,有些地方需要付费,比如游戏里面购买装备。一般来说AppStore分为两种应用程序,免费和付费,如果需要你付费下载的,您能看到它的费用是多少。对于站内应用程序,软件通常是免费下载的,但是如果您想要在软件中实现更多的功能,则必须付费才能使用它。
苹果app是用什么开发的
1、苹果APP主要使用Objective-C语言和Swift语言进行开发。Objective-C语言 Objective-C是苹果APP开发中最常用的编程语言之一。它是基于C语言衍生出来的,添加了面向对象编程的特性。
2、iPad上用的APP应用程序主要是用Xcode软件在mac系统中编写制作的。具体说明如下: Xcode软件:Xcode是苹果公司专门为开发者设计的集成开发环境,用于开发Mac OS X和iOS的应用程序。它是开发iOS应用不可或缺的工具。 mac系统:由于Xcode是苹果公司开发的软件,因此它只能在macOS操作系统上运行。
3、苹果手机app制作主要使用的是Swift或Objective-C语言。Swift语言:特点:Swift是一种强大且直观的编程语言,专为开发iOS、macOS、watchOS和tvOS应用而设计。它结合了C和Objective-C的优点,并去除了它们的一些复杂性。Swift的语法简洁明了,使得代码更加易读易写。
4、Mac应用程序可以使用多种编程语言进行开发,以下是一些常见的开发语言:Objective-C:简介:这是苹果公司为Mac OS X和iOS开发的原生语言。用途:被广泛用于开发Mac OS X应用程序,是早期Mac应用开发的主流语言。Swift:简介:Swift是苹果公司于2014年推出的编程语言。
5、它是Android平台中开发APP应用程序,包括IAP(应用内购买)、广告以及特殊系统功能时常用的开发语言。一般开发安卓APP软件主要使用的编程语言也是Java,如果在开发过程中需要切换语言,可以通过JNI(Java Native Interface,Java本地接口)来完成。
6、开发一个应用程序(App)可以使用多种编程语言,具体选择取决于多个因素。以下是一些常见的应用开发语言及其适用场景:原生应用开发 iOS:Swift 或 Objective-C。这两种语言是苹果官方推荐的开发语言,适用于iOS平台的原生应用开发。Android:Java 或 Kotlin。
